The above tips are rather general and will apply to buying a home warranty in just about any state. However, there are some specific things you’ll want to keep in mind in Mississippi as well that can help narrow down your options.
First, you should consider that the state receives well above the national average precipitation every year and extreme weather events. Mississippi residents contend with an average of 55.9 inches of rain, plus high winds and hurricanes, all of which make roof leaks more of an issue. Most residents look for coverage that includes roof leak protection.
Second, the temperatures in Mississippi can be blisteringly hot in the summers, reaching into the high 80s and 90s in the summer months. These high temperatures can put added stress on your cooling system, refrigerators, and freezers, and overworking them can lead to breakdowns. It’s wise to get a home warranty that includes ACs and these appliances.
A home warranty is a protection plan for your appliances and home systems. It acts somewhat like a home insurance policy in that it provides protection for things in your home and covers the costs of unexpected maintenance and replacements.
Home warranties come with an annual cost, plus you’ll have to pay a service fee averaging around $85 for every claim you file with your home warranty service provider. Home warranties also have coverage limits per item and on a yearly basis, which limit how much coverage you’ll receive for damages.
While it’s convenient to compare home warranties and homeowners insurance, the two actually differ in several important ways.
First, homeowners insurance is a general policy that covers total damage to your home. For example, it might payout a single lump sum after damage caused by a hurricane, but it doesn’t cover individual appliances or home systems like a home warranty does. With a home warranty, you can file smaller claims for smaller issues, like a fridge failing to work because of old age.
Second, a home warranty requires very little for a “qualifying event.” If you have coverage for your heating system and your boiler goes down unexpectedly, your warranty coverage will likely kick in. On the other hand, a qualifying event for home insurance is usually a catastrophe, like a fire, flood, or natural disaster. Homeowners insurance claims are rare, while home warranty claims can be filed multiple times per year.
Finally, the deductible or out-of-pocket costs you pay for each will vary quite a bit. A homeowners insurance policy often requires that you pay several thousands of dollars before coverage kicks in, although the coverage cap is usually in the hundreds of thousands. With a home warranty, your only out-of-pocket cost in most cases will be the $85 service fee, and the coverage caps are in the thousands most of the time.

Every home warranty plan is different, so the coverage included in your home warranty will vary based on your provider and individual plan. Most options cover appliances or home systems, and there are comprehensive plan options that include coverage for both.
If you choose a plan that covers appliances, chances are you’ll get protection for your refrigerator, oven, stove, microwave, dishwasher, washing machine, clothes dryer, and garbage disposal. Some lower-tier plans don’t include refrigerators or washers and dryers. If you choose a plan that covers systems, you’ll be looking at coverage for your plumbing, heating, electrical, and cooling systems. Most also include water heaters and other minor systems, like garage door openers.
You will also likely have your pick of add-on coverage options. These are added a la carte to existing plans, and none are included in the plan cost. Common add-on options are for pools, spas, additional refrigerators, sump pumps, and more.
As is the case with coverages included, every plan will exclude different items. For a list of what yours covers, you should always check your service contract. The most common general exclusions are for intentional damage, issues caused by a lack of maintenance, pre-existing conditions in your home, and cosmetic repairs.
Although home warranties are generally positive and end up saving people money, there are some complaints we see often from homeowners in Mississippi about their coverage and plan providers.
One of the most common issues reported is higher out-of-pocket costs for certain problems. Things like roof leaks and fridge replacements can often exceed coverage caps, so be sure you understand the maximum payout your warranty company will provide.
Another issue commonly reported is companies denying claims that are for covered items. In some cases, this could be due to limitations in the coverage or exclusions, like damages to your HVAC system because you failed to maintain it properly. These denials can be genuine, but they can also occur if you choose a warranty from a less reputable company. We recommend only working with a trusted provider, like those mentioned above.

The service fee is the price you pay for a repair technician to come to your home and inspect and repair a broken appliance or system. The service fee is typically the only cost incurred by a homeowner when they have a home warranty in place. Service fees range in price from $60 to $150.
